Factors for Calibration Accuracy
Calibration accuracy in water activity meters hinges largely on the quality of the standard solutions and the device’s ability to maintain precise adjustments over time. I look for meters that support straightforward calibration procedures, allowing manual adjustments to keep measurements accurate. Stable sensors are essential; they should provide consistent readings with minimal drift, guaranteeing calibration remains valid. Regular calibration checks using certified reference standards are indispensable to verify ongoing accuracy. High-quality meters often come factory calibrated and permit user calibration or corrections, which help compensate for environmental changes or sensor wear. These features collectively ensure dependable measurements, critical for research and quality control. Sensor Technology and Reliability
Choosing the right sensor technology is key to guaranteeing reliable water activity measurements in the lab. Advanced non-conductive humidity sensors are indispensable, as they provide consistent and accurate results across various sample types and conditions. High precision sensors with an accuracy of ±0.02 aw help deliver trustworthy data essential for food safety and quality control. Many reliable meters incorporate smart equilibrium algorithms, which monitor stability and confirm when samples reach true moisture equilibrium, boosting measurement confidence. Regular calibration with standard solutions like saturated sodium chloride is critical to maintain sensor accuracy over time. Additionally, the durability and stability of sensor components play a significant role in long-term reliability, especially when operating in demanding laboratory environments. Proper sensor technology ensures consistent, precise, and dependable water activity readings.
Measurement Range and Resolution
Selecting a water activity meter requires careful consideration of both its measurement range and resolution to guarantee accurate results. The measurement range usually spans from 0 to 1.0 aw, covering all moisture levels relevant to food and materials. Ensuring the range fits your specific needs is essential; some applications need precise detection in low moisture products, while others require broader coverage. Resolution indicates the smallest detectable change in water activity, often ±0.01 aw or better, which is critical for detecting subtle differences. High-resolution meters enable more precise measurements, fundamental for quality control and research purposes. Combining an appropriate measurement range with high resolution improves the reliability and sensitivity of your testing, ensuring you get consistent, meaningful data in your laboratory work.

Can Water Activity Meters Detect Microbial Contamination Levels?
Yes, water activity meters can help indicate potential microbial contamination levels, but they don’t directly measure microbes. Lower water activity usually means less microbial growth, so these meters are useful for evaluating safety risks indirectly. I recommend combining water activity readings with microbial testing for accurate contamination detection. Proper calibration and maintenance ensure reliable results, helping you monitor and control microbial risks effectively in your lab.

How Do Environmental Conditions Affect Water Activity Measurements?
Environmental conditions like temperature and humidity notably impact water activity measurements. I’ve learned that fluctuations in temperature can alter water availability in samples, leading to inaccurate readings. Humidity levels can also affect the instrument’s accuracy if not properly controlled. That’s why I always guarantee a stable environment, using calibrated instruments and consistent conditions, so my measurements remain precise and reliable regardless of external factors.
